We are seeking compassionate and motivated Care Assistants to join our team in the Coventry & Nuneaton area. Based in the local community, you will play a vital role in supporting children, young people, and adults to live better lives by delivering high-quality home care services.
Responsibilities
- Provide personalized care and support to clients in their own homes.
- Assist with daily living activities such as personal hygiene, meal preparation, and medication reminders.
- Follow individual care plans to ensure each client’s needs are met.
- Maintain accurate records of care provided.
- Communicate effectively with clients, families, and team members.
- Promote independence and well-being of clients.
- Support clients with mobility and transportation as needed.
- Adhere to health and safety policies at all times.
